Barcelona have reportedly offered £90m + two players to see the return of Neymar to the Camp Nou.

The Brazilian superstar left Catalonia for Paris Saint-Germain in the summer of 2017 in a bid to win the Ballon d’Or and the Champions League.

To this date neither have been achieved and maybe it is a typical case of  ‘the grass isn’t always greener on the other side of the fence’.

Although Neymar has bagged a sensational 58 goals in 64 matches for the Parisians, his time there has been marred by injury and a fan frustration at his constant efforts of simulation.

Would Neymar return to Barcelona, the club that made him in Europe, and return to the shadow of Lionel Messi?

Well that is a much more successful shadow than the one he is currently under in France, with Kylian Mbappe taking all the plaudits this season for PSG.

People forget how good Neymar was at Barcelona and how everyone was tipping him to be the best player after the retirement of Messi and Cristiano Ronaldo. He won two La Liga’s, three Copa Del Reys and a Champions League with Barca, and will look to add to that collection if he does return this summer.

There are six players rumoured to be heading the other way if the deal does go through. Two of which commanded £100m+ fees themselves in Ousmane Dembele and Phillippe Coutinho, but evidently the Camp Nou hierarchy would willingly dispose to see the former Santos man return.

The other four players are Ivan Rakitic, Nelson Semedo, Samuel Umtiti and Malcom.

It is a struggle to see Paris accepting this offer but if the cash sum was upped and the deal was wanted by both parties, it should certainly be completed. The saga of the summer?
